当前位置:首页 / EXCEL

如何旋转Excel表格?如何操作实现旋转?

作者:佚名|分类:EXCEL|浏览:100|发布时间:2025-04-04 22:57:51

如何旋转Excel表格?如何操作实现旋转?

在Excel中,旋转表格是一种常见的操作,尤其是在处理图表或数据透视表时。以下是如何在Excel中旋转表格以及如何操作实现旋转的详细步骤。

旋转Excel表格的步骤

1. 打开Excel文件

首先,打开你想要旋转的Excel文件。

2. 选择表格或图表

在Excel中,你可以旋转表格或图表。选择你想要旋转的表格或图表。如果你选择的是表格,你可以通过以下方式选择:

如果表格是连续的单元格,你可以点击表格中的任意单元格,然后按下`Ctrl+Shift+*`(星号键)来选择整个表格。

如果表格是分散的单元格区域,你可以手动选择每个区域。

对于图表,直接点击图表即可选中。

3. 使用“格式”选项卡

选中表格或图表后,Excel的“格式”选项卡会出现在功能区中。

4. 旋转表格或图表

在“格式”选项卡中,找到“排列”组,然后点击“旋转”。

5. 选择旋转角度

在弹出的菜单中,你可以选择预定义的旋转角度,如90度、180度、270度等,或者输入你想要的旋转角度。

6. 应用旋转

选择好旋转角度后,点击“确定”或“应用”按钮,表格或图表就会按照你选择的角度旋转。

如何操作实现旋转

除了使用“格式”选项卡中的旋转功能,你还可以通过以下方法实现旋转:

方法一:使用快捷键

对于表格,你可以使用`Ctrl+1`打开“格式单元格”对话框,然后在“对齐”选项卡中找到旋转按钮。

对于图表,你可以使用`Ctrl+1`打开“设置图表区域格式”对话框,然后在“排列”选项卡中找到旋转按钮。

方法二:使用VBA宏

如果你经常需要旋转表格或图表,可以使用VBA宏来自动化这个过程。以下是一个简单的VBA宏示例,用于旋转选中的图表:

```vba

Sub RotateChart()

Dim chartObj As ChartObject

Set chartObj = ActiveSheet.ChartObjects(1) ' 选择第一个图表对象

With chartObj.Chart

.HasTitle = False

.Axes(x, AxisTypePrimary).HasTitle = False

.Axes(y, AxisTypePrimary).HasTitle = False

.Axes(x, AxisTypePrimary).AxisPosition = AxisPositionLow

.Axes(y, AxisTypePrimary).AxisPosition = AxisPositionLow

.Rotation = 90 ' 旋转90度

End With

End Sub

```

将此代码复制到Excel的VBA编辑器中,并运行宏,即可旋转选中的图表。

相关问答

1. 如何旋转整个工作表?

要旋转整个工作表,你可以使用以下步骤:

点击“视图”选项卡。

在“工作视图”组中,点击“页面布局”。

在“页面布局”中,找到“旋转”按钮,并选择你想要的旋转角度。

2. 旋转后的表格或图表可以再调整大小吗?

是的,旋转后的表格或图表可以再调整大小。你可以通过以下方式调整:

选中旋转后的表格或图表。

使用鼠标拖动表格或图表的角点来调整大小。

3. 旋转表格时,数据会改变吗?

旋转表格本身不会改变数据。旋转只是改变了表格的显示方向,数据的内容和结构保持不变。

4. 如何旋转图表中的轴标签?

在“设置图表区域格式”对话框中,你可以找到轴标签并旋转它们。选择相应的轴标签,然后使用“文本框”选项卡中的旋转功能来调整标签的角度。


参考内容:https://www.chaobian.net/game/629.html